While the base salary starts at $100,000 there is no limit to visits or productivity bonuses.Job Description:Physical Therapist is responsible for comprehensive assessments in the patient's home, including the completion of skilled documentation through KanTime.Evaluate patients and perform appropriate therapy interventionsDevelop a comprehensive plan of care and coordinate multi-disciplinary carePerform prompt clinical documentation and visit notesContinued communication with physician, care team members, patient and familyComfortable working in all aspects of the home health settingImplement and maintain physical therapy protocolsManage patient treatment and outcomes directly, or through PTA supervisionRequirements:Professional appearance and effective communication skillsCurrent Texas Physical Therapist (PT) licenseOne year of physical therapy experienceCurrent Texas driver's licenseCPR certificationExperience with healthcare software (EMREHR) PreferredPrevious Home Health experience is helpful, but not requiredJob Type: Full-TimeSchedule:Monday to FridayWeekendsLicenseCertification:BLS Certification (Required)Physical Therapy License (Required)Work Location:Houston and AustinEMR Used:KanTime- Requirements The productivity scale is designed to assess and track the workload of home health physical therapists based on a weekly total of 28 points. It considers various aspects of a therapist's role, including evaluations, patient visits, OASIS tasks, and discharges. Administrative or supervisory tasks will be awarded productivity points on a case-by-case basis. Physical Therapists Evaluations, Re-Evaluations, and OASIS Recertification's - 1.5 Points Patient Visit - 1 Point OASIS Start of Care and Resumption of Care - 3 Points OASIS Discharges and PT Discipline Discharges - 1.5 Points Non-Billable Discharges - 0.5 Points Total Weekly Full-Time Points Required: 28 Productivity Guidelines: Tracking: Productivity will be tracked weekly, from Monday through Sunday. Productivity Bonus: You may accept and complete as many visits as you would like after your productivity goal has been met. For every point beyond your required goal, you will receive a bonus rate, equivalent to the current company PRN rate: PT visit $75 (per point) Review: Regular performance check-ins will be held to provide feedback and address any areas for improvement. It is expected that you will make every effort to complete your productivity requirement. If you have met your productivity requirement for the week, communicate to the scheduling team if you wish to pass on any incoming new referrals to another therapist. Mileage Reimbursement This policy outlines the guidelines for mileage reimbursement for home health therapists at Adaptive Home Health. It is designed to compensate employees for the use of their personal vehicles while traveling to and from patient homes, ensuring fair and accurate reimbursement for work-related travel. Adaptive Home Health will reimburse therapists for mileage traveled while performing their job duties. Reimbursement is calculated at a rate of $0.62 per mile, with a deduction for an average commute to account for travel between home and the first or last patient visit. Reimbursement Rate: Rate: $0.62 per mile Deduction: 30 miles per day (to account for the average commute)
